INCIDENT: Pedestrian Safety and Distracted Driving Campaign
DATE/TIME: Friday April 17th, 2015 8am-3pm
LOCATION: Various intersections within Pomona
UNIT: Traffic Services
The Pomona Police Department continued its enforcement efforts today by enforcing behaviors and actions that are dangerous to pedestrians and motorists alike.
Operations were conducted in various locations within Pomona specifically addressing drivers that fail to yield to pedestrians in crosswalks as well as distracted drivers. These behaviors can and do lead to serious collisions.
25 drivers were issued citations for failing to yield to pedestrians in crosswalks and 17 drivers were cited for cell phone/texting violations.
The Pomona Police Department will continue its efforts to reduce collisions and injuries to everyone who travels our roads.
